Cheap Parking in Downtown SLO: How to Pay Less
What are the cheapest parking spots in Downtown SLO?
The most affordable parking in Downtown SLO can be found in the outer areas where rates are set at $2.25 per hour. If you’re planning to stay longer, consider the parking garages, which charge $2 per hour and have a maximum daily rate of $8.

Are there any discount apps for parking in Downtown SLO?
While there are no specific discount apps for parking in Downtown SLO, you can easily pay for parking through the city’s parking app, which streamlines the payment process. This app allows you to pay without the hassle of coins, making it a convenient option for visitors.

Can I find street parking in Downtown SLO?
Yes, street parking is available in Downtown SLO but be mindful of the rates and time limits. The 10-hour meters in the outer downtown area charge $2.25 per hour, so plan accordingly to avoid any parking citations.
